Sunrise provides specialist marine and offshore installation services to suit marine environments, supported by extensive in-house design and fabrication capabilities. Sunrise can provide GRE installation services to a wide range of systems including:
Sunrise can supply and install NOV GRE pipe systems to the offshore markets. We work Closely with NOV Fiber Glass Systems (FGS) who are worldwide leaders in the GRE Industry. Sunrise design and builds high performance pipe and fittings systems specifically for the requirements pertaining to offshore piping. Compliance with and participation in the development of industry standards by IMO, ABS, USCG, LR and others have positioned FGS as the leading supplier of marine-grade fiberglass pipe. Design variations include elevated external pressure resistance (for in-tank piping), electrical conductivity (for areas designated as hazardous), low smoke and toxicity (for confined spaces and passageways) and fire endurance.
Full Engineering support is available for system design, stress analysis, material take off and spool pre-fabrication, where value is added in doing so.

Sunrise works with NOV in supplying GRE pipes to provide a cost-effective composite installation and repair solutions for ageing offshore piping and pipelines that are affected by corrosion. Our workforce includes multi-skilled and approved Bonders / QA Supervision meeting ISO 14692 requirements. Our team can perform a wide range of complex tasks safely and efficient, thus keeping on board personnel to a minimum.
NOV Fiberglass Systems (FGS) products have been developed to meet the demanding requirements and regulations associated with the Offshore market, whether on fixed, floating, ship shaped or custom designed facilities. Exposure to the corrosive sea environment, as well various grades of water being conveyed inside the pipe, makes FGS the product supplier of choice for a wide variety of systems from Fire protection to Deck drains.
Sunrise personnel work closely with project engineers, owners and yards to provide the products and services needed for success. Product variations are available where specific demands require properties such as vacuum or external pressure resistance, electrical conductivity or fire endurance, even to the level of resisting exposure to jet fire.
